Experts voice safety concerns about new pebble-bed nuclear reactors

Friday, August 24, 2018 - 10:00 in Physics & Chemistry

Researchers advise caution as a commercial-scale nuclear reactor known as HTR-PM prepares to become operational in China. The reactor is a pebble-bed, high-temperature gas-cooled reactor (HTGR), a design that is ostensibly safer but that researchers in the US and Germany warn does not eliminate the possibility of a serious accident.
